Handover — landlord site audit. Grayce from Orlin Estates arrives Thursday 09:00 to inspect floors 2–4 at Tanner's Reach. New starters: keep desks clear, no boxes in corridors, fire doors shut. I've booked the Juniper room for her paperwork. Escort her at all times. She'll need the service corridor; the door code for that run is below.

turnstile pass: bdg-YPPQB-52010

MEMO — Hiring Freeze, Fieldworks Division

Effective immediately, all open requisitions in the Fieldworks Division are frozen. No exceptions without sign-off from T. Marroway. Contractor extensions beyond 30 days also require approval. Offers already issued will be honoured. Backfill requests will be reviewed at the next quarterly headcount session. Department heads should brief their leads verbally only. Context for this decision follows below.

confidential, kagup-bafog: Fraaxax Group is in early talks to buy Soroxox Group for about $343.8 million. The Olidor launch date is June 14, and nothing goes to the press before then. Legal wants the Aldmirek Logistics term sheet signed before July 23.

Subject: Rounding fix shipped — Tillgate converter

Future maintainers: the Tillgate currency converter truncated instead of rounding on sub-cent conversions, drifting totals by up to 0.4% on batch jobs. Fixed in this release by switching to scaled integers end to end. Do not reintroduce floats in the ledger path. The build token for this release follows.

session token of bahip-hawep = htk4_b0c1